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,342,198,560
Lastest Block:
1,993,394
Utxos:
1,986,069
Nodes:
331
OmniXEP Contracts:
280
Block details
[STAKE]
22/04/2024 12:22:40 UTC
Txid
2c5eb1cf2a198565b74602394d2c880e1069102cffdf8389f9828e56438c8275
Block
1,309,666
Block hash
5d4f1237dd18805f2844dc24e4444cb9c0647362699bb5d67e2914d38900b038
Stake amount
152.19034348 XEP
Sender
ep1qnt48wczkuvctqz7rcygfde9j8m74vqamrg8vgl
Recipient
ep1qkflx20cw0a5qcjks6786ru3shlys7p4fmyrq4l
(2,153,735.18908381 XEP)